In the fast-paced world of CSGO, mastering strategies for ESL showdowns is essential for any competitive player. Start by focusing on communication with your team. A well-coordinated squad can make or break a match, so ensure that all players utilize headsets and are on the same page regarding tactics. Utilize tools like in-game voice chat or third-party applications like Discord to maintain clear communication. Always prepare an effective tactic before entering the match, whether it's a default setup or a specific strategy tailored to counter your opponent's strengths.
Another key strategy is to analyze previous matches, both your own and your opponents'. Understanding the patterns of play during ESL showdowns can give you a critical edge. Use this analysis to create a comprehensive plan, including understanding which maps suit your team's strengths and where you generally perform better. Furthermore, consider incorporating a mix of aggressive and passive play styles to keep your opponents guessing. Remember to review and adapt your strategies based on the evolving meta, ensuring that your approach remains fresh and unpredictable.

The evolution of ESL showdowns has significantly transformed the landscape of competitive esports. Since its inception, the Electronic Sports League (ESL) has grown from small local competitions to become one of the most prestigious organizations in the esports industry. Initially dominated by a few major titles, ESL has expanded its scope to include a diverse array of games, catering to a global audience. This shift not only reflects the growing interest in competitive gaming but also highlights the increasing professionalism and organization surrounding these events.
As we delve into the history of ESL, it is evident that the competitive play aspect has been pivotal in shaping its operations. From early online tournaments to large-scale LAN events, the format has evolved to embrace a range of competitive structures, including leagues, knockout stages, and seasonal championships. Fans now witness thrilling matches featuring top-tier talent, enriched by advancements in streaming technology and audience engagement. This continuous evolution not only enhances the viewing experience but also elevates the status of esports as a legitimate entertainment platform.
Preparing for ESL Showdowns is essential for aspiring CSGO players who aim to compete at a high level. To start, it is crucial to develop your skills through practice and analysis. First, dedicate time each day to improve your aim and reflexes. Utilize training maps in CSGO or aim trainers to refine your shooting precision. Secondly, understanding game mechanics such as economy management and positioning can give you an edge. Watching professional matches can provide valuable insights into strategies and teamwork, helping you to adapt and learn from the best in the business.
